  • Teaching English for young learners is not as simple as teaching English to adults because for young learners learning English will be more impressed by experiencing it with their own real life. In teaching English for young learners, the teacher must think to create enjoyable atmosphere in teaching learning process. Therefore, the teacher must be creative to think about how to be smart teacher, have good lesson plan, good matterials and also proper teaching media. In this research, the researcher chooses the teaching media to support the teaching learning process. The using of teaching media is the great importance to deliver the knowledge, because young learners like studying with fun. The objectives of this study were to know the teaching media used by the teacher in teaching English at EYL class at English First course in Malang, to describe the problems faced by the EYL teacher at English First course in using media and to describe how the teachers at English First course solve the problems. The design of this study was descriptive qualitative research by taking two English teachers who were teaching English for Young Learner class. They were a local teacher and native English speaker. In collecting the data, the researcher used two kinds of instruments: interview and observation. The finding showed that the teachers used visual and audio-visual media in teaching English at EYL class at English First course in Malang. Visual media used were picture, game and whiteboard. Audio-visual media were video and computer. The teachers did not get any problems in using teaching media because they could handle the situation when the difficulty appeared suddenly.
